Pyrexia in dogs is a condition that is defined as an elevation of body temperature above the normal range. It is most common in older dogs, but it can occur in any age. Pyrexia can have a number of causes, ranging from infections to metabolic diseases to trauma. Common signs of pyrexia include panting, listlessness, loss of appetite, and glassy eyes. It is important to diagnose and treat the underlying cause in order to relieve the dog of pyrexia. The most common cause of pyrexia in dogs is infection, either bacterial or viral. Bacterial infections can be caused by a variety of bacteria, including E. coli, salmonella, and staphylococcus. Viral infections include parvovirus, distemper, and rabies. All of these infections can be spread through indirect contact, such as through the air, shared surfaces, or contact with a dog that is already infected. Treatment of the infection, with antibiotics or antivirals, is necessary to reduce the pyrexia. Pyrexia can also be caused by metabolic diseases such as diabetes, liver or kidney disease, and immune-mediated diseases such as arthritis or lupus. These conditions interfere with the dog’s natural regulation of its body temperature, leading to increases in body temperature. Treatment of the underlying disease is the only way to reduce the pyrexia. Finally, some dogs may develop pyrexia after trauma. Trauma can lead to inflammation and swelling, which can increase the dog’s body temperature. Treatment of the trauma is necessary to reduce the pyrexia. In conclusion, pyrexia in dogs is a condition that is caused by a variety of factors, from infections to metabolic diseases to trauma. It is important to diagnose the underlying cause so that it can be treated effectively and the dog can be relieved of pyrexia.
